Legislation authored by James Madison Coffey

Includes legislation with James Madison Coffey as the primary author for the 39th through 39th Legislatures. For other types of authorship, search the Legislative Archive System.
Please note author information is not complete for the 43rd through 45th Legislatures or for sessions prior to the 30th.

39th Regular Session
HB 88 Caption: Relating to making an appropriation for the purchase of certain lands for the College of Industrial Arts in Denton, Texas.
HB 258 Caption: Relating to amending certain statute by striking out the date January 1, 1900, and inserting in lieu thereof the date January 1, 1920.
HB 268 Caption: Relating to providing for the voluntary registration of land titles in this State, prescribing the procedure, the duties of officers in relation thereto, the venue, the form of registration certificates and the recording thereof, for the appointment of examiner and fees to be charged in such proceedings.
HB 308 Caption: Relating to establishing a system of public roads and bridges for Denton County and empowering the commissioners court thereof to provide rules and regulations therefor, and a system for the construction of such road and bridge, the maintenance and repair thereof, and condemning private property for such purposes; prescribing penalties for the violation of this act, and repealing all laws in conflict with the provisions hereof.
